Q: How does the warranty work? Does it have to be installed by a Kohler certified dealer for the warranty work? by Franz Gerster from New York on December 13, 2012
A: Kohler does not require a Kohler certified installer only a minimum would be a certified electrician.
When a Kohler installer does the installation and start-up the warranty starts the day he starts the unit.
When a certified electrician installs and starts the unit the warranty starts the day the unit was shipped from the factory.
All service and warranty work must be completed by an authorized Kohler service technician.
Q: What is the purpose of a 200 amp transfer switch if it is not service entrance rated? by Joel from New York on October 06, 2012
A: A service disconnect can be installed prior to the switch allowing for whole house applications or a specific "emergency" sub-panel can be installed with the switch connected to the sub-panel which the generator would power only.
Q: Does the Kohler 20 kw 20RESAL come with a base or pad? if not what is required? by Jim Mestl from New York on October 04, 2012
A: The unit has a composite pad already installed on the unit but a solid foundation base is required which can be either concrete, crushed stone or pea gravel a minimum of 3 inches thick.

Q: Jim, Is this item dual fuel or just one or the other NG or LP? Also, what should I expect on ballpark pricing to have this unit installed by an electrician? Finally, what does the Load control module do for me? Do I need it? Thanks, Art by Art Aldridge from Arkansas on August 31, 2012
A: This model will run on either LP or natural gas with the fuel selected at time of install. No additional parts are required.
Install costs vary. Anecdotal only, and based on my Kohler 18kW installed at my home, the install cost was $2200. This was for gas and electric connections. Mine was a 'middle of the road' install - only 20' from the meters & I did a service entrance switch mounted outside past the meter & between the load center.
If you go with a Generac machine, you can install DLM's or relay blocks to drop out certain high amperage loads which only allow them to power on if the generator has sufficient power remaining to start them. Unless you have multiple 4-5ton A/C units or other large amp draw items, this isn't needed on a 20kW. The best way to install a Kohler is to segregate the loads you want in a sub panel. Then you know that every time the generator starts you will be able to power up all of those items. And, 75amps is a lot of power that goes a long way to keep a home comfortable without utility power. by Jim, Product Expert

Q: Hi Jim, What is the difference between the 20resl and 20resal? I don't see the composite pad on this unit 20resal? Thanks, Steve by Steve from New Jersey on February 21, 2012
A: The new "A" version has the following features added: ** New Controller - RDC2/DC2 - New display readable in direct sunlight, 2 lines, 16 characters per line, no more codes. - Built-In 2.5A battery charger using 120 VAC allowing deletion of the separate 6A battery charger - Includes Ethernet Board, so no hardware required to be installed for OnCue - RDC2 has built-in LED's on controller overlay to view status of RXT transfer switch and source availability while standing at the genset - Real Time Clock - Allows setting of Exercise for any time and day you want - Internal protection, no controller fuses to service - Controller is fully potted for protection against snow and moisture
** New Silencer design to reduce sound levels - 14RESA sound level during exercise is 63 dBA, and 67 dBA during normal operation - 20RESA sound level during exercise is 64 dBA, and 69 dBA during normal operation
The composite pad is the same color as the entire unit and already attached to the bottom of the generator. by Jim, Product Expert

Tips For New Buyers
I finally got the unit installed (the delay was from the local contractors & utilities; delivery was in two days) and it purrs like a kitten. The voltage under load varies by two, frequency by 0.3Hz.
You can get a transfer switch with the service disconnect built in. I was replacing the pole and forty year old meter/service disconnect. The new meter socket had an integrated 200 amp service disconnect/breaker so I really didn't need the disconnect in the transfer switch.
My electrician was able to put in the new meter/disconnect, transfer switch, small breaker for the generator's charger and heater, and a outlet on the new single pole.
Tip 1: The lifting holes in the base will not accept a heavy enough chain to lift it. You don't want the chain scuffing things up anyway. Three quarter inch nylon rope is enough and works great. You need machine power or heavy bars and at least six people on them to lift into place. It is 500 pounds after all!
Tip 2: The composite base says you can place it directly on three inches of small river rock. I used gravel common in Iowa and then set solid concrete half blocks as a full coverage base. I also oriented it so that the predominate wind out of the West would flow through the generator rather than have the outlet side fighting the wind.
Tip 3: Everything about the Carb Heater says to plug it into a supplied outlet outside the engine compartment. There is no outlet outside the engine compartment. It is inside, on the right bulkhead towards the back.
Tip 4: Start the unit manually and let it run until it smooths out. It will surge and flutter until the LP line is completely purged of air and running pure. Even then, during the weekly exercise you will swear that you can hear a small flutter but when in use it is completely smooth.
Tip 5: I placed the unit at the service disconnect for the farm which is about a hundred feet from the house. To notice if it has switched to standby I had the electrician install a small light fixture on the pole and wired it to the generator lugs of the transfer switch.
Tip 6: I am going to build a three foot long wrench to open/close the oil drain valve. Otherwise, you have to dismantle the case before running to warm up the oil. Or burn your arm reaching in the small space between the exhaust and case to reach the valve at the bottom.
Tip 7: Don't attach the battery if the unit is not going to be connected (the charger circuit) for a few weeks. It will run the battery down quickly.

My Story
After spending weeks considering various generators, I chose this one- one reason being that it came with a composite base, another being the 5-year warranty.
Everything arrived on time and was as advertised. I had it off-loaded from the semi onto a cart (2000 pound capacity) pulled by my riding lawnmower. Getting it sited was somewhat a chore as it weighs 500 pounds and we had to go up a grade and around bushes and trees next to the house where my riding lawnmower had no traction (or sufficient power) and my Kubota tractor couldn’t get in.
After carefully (and slowly) unloading it as close to the final site as possible, we pushed it up the last 100 feet around the various obstacles using PVC pipe as rollers, though the going got slow when we hit a patch of sand. Nevertheless, two men and one woman were all it took to get it in place.
The electrician who hooked it up was surprised by the low price. He was impressed when we found that the generator would easily run both 5-ton air conditioners at the same time. He said he preferred it to other generators he had installed.
On his advice, I added the carburetor heater as it can get cold here in northern Ohio. Overall, I am quite pleased with my purchase.
